Security windows

The majority of burglars stay away from homes with double glazing because it is harder to break through two panes glass than one. It also creates noise, so burglars would prefer to find an alternative entry point. It is essential to keep in mind that double-glazed windows aren't burglar-proof. Installing security measures will decrease the likelihood of an intruder.

Some windows are designed to give security for your home, while others can be upgraded by adding more locks and bolts to offer additional security. Multi-point locks, for instance can be put in place to secure the window in various places and to prevent it from being opened by accident. Installing a hinge restrictor can restrict the size of the window's opening and stop intruders from getting rid of the frame.

Another way to improve the security of double-glazed windows is by adding the security film. This type of security films is available in clear finishes that are invisible to the naked eyes, or in translucent patterns that can block out the view outside, but allow the light to pass through. It is easy to cut, and can be put on existing windows to secure them.

The type of glass you use in your double-glazed windows can also make a difference. There are many options to choose from, including abrasion resistant and laminated glass.
